Title:
ORGANIC SOLVENT RECOVERY SYSTEM
Document Type and Number:
WIPO Patent Application WO/2023/190214
Kind Code:
A1
Abstract:
The organic solvent recovery system according to the present invention comprises: an organic solvent recovery device that has a first adsorbent and comprises at least three treatment tanks alternatingly performing an adsorption treatment in which organic solvents are adsorbed by the first adsorbent from a to-be-treated gas that has been introduced from a to-be-treated gas supply flow path and in which a first treated gas is discharged, a desorption treatment in which water vapor is used to desorb organic solvents from the first adsorbent and in which desorbed gas is discharged, and a drying treatment in which the first adsorbent is dried by drying gas and in which a dry outlet gas is discharged; an organic solvent concentration device that has a second adsorbent, adsorbs an organic solvent into the second adsorbent from the first treated gas discharged from the organic solvent recovery device, discharges a second treated gas, and uses desorbing gas to desorb the organic solvent from the second adsorbent so as to discharge the organic solvent as a concentrated gas; and a return flow path that returns the concentrated gas discharged from the organic solvent concentration device to the to-be-treated gas supply flow path.
